←back to thread

311 points melodyogonna | 3 comments | | HN request time: 0.77s | source
Show context
blizdiddy ◴[] No.45138079[source]
Mojo is the enshitification of programming. Learning a language is too much cognitive investment for VC rugpulls. You make the entire compiler and runtime GPL or you pound sand, that has been the bar for decades. If the new cohort of programmers can’t hold the line, we’ll all suffer.
replies(2): >>45138103 #>>45142189 #
pjmlp ◴[] No.45138103[source]
For decades, paying for compiler tools was a thing.
replies(5): >>45138331 #>>45138346 #>>45140159 #>>45143394 #>>45149506 #
1. const_cast ◴[] No.45143394[source]
Yes and it sucked, and those companies who relied on that largely got conned into it and then saw their tooling slowly decay and their application becomes legacy garbage.

Its not just that OS tooling is "free", it's also better and works for way longer. If you relied on proprietary Delphi-compatible tooling, well... you fucked up!

replies(1): >>45146854 #
2. pjmlp ◴[] No.45146854[source]
You mean like the tooling for iOS, Nintendo, PlayStation, XBox, Windows, CUDA?
replies(1): >>45172568 #
3. const_cast ◴[] No.45172568[source]
Um... yes? If you built your app around COM+, you're fucked. I would know, I worked on an application like that. Perpetually stuck in decades long gone.

Or NextSTEP. Or DX 9. Or whatever the fuck.

That shit sucked when it came out and it's only gotten worse. The cherry on top is the companies that promised they're the bees knees actually know that, which is why they left them to die. And, unfortunately, your applications along with them.